CHINESE METHODS.

USING LOAN FOR ELECTIONS. By Teleffrnpli.—Press Assn.—Copyrijlit. New York, Dec. 2". A dispatch from Tientsin states that the Tientsin Government Mint has concluded a million dollar loan with the Chino-French Bank' under which the bank can purchase all bullion and take charge of the output of silver dollars and copper coins. .It is understood that the funds supplied through the hank are Japanese. It is rumored that a large part of the loan will be used by the military and civil Governments of the Chihili Province for election expenses and control of the new Parliament.

Chinese bankers have sent a protest to the Chinese Government alleging that the Chirio-French bank's control of the mint's output will bfi highly detrimental to native banking interests.
